A federal court awarded surviving spouse benefits to the surviving partner of a same-sex couple who were prohibited from marrying because of now-unconstitutional state law that banned same-sex marriage. Thornton v. Commissioner of Social Security, Case No. C18-1409JLR, (U.S. District Court, Western District of Washington,...

The Strengthening Protections for Social Security Beneficiaries Act of 2018 (Strengthening Protections Act) amended the Social Security Act to allow for the advance designation of representative payees for recipients of Social Security and other governmental benefits.
